Replay QA ("tells you what is broken before your users do") hit #4 on Product Hunt July 20 with 415 votes, four days after Manta AI shipped autonomous web app testing. Two independent launches in the same narrow slot inside a week is a category forming, not coincidence. Both target QA headcount rather than the test-authoring tool, meaning the displaced spend is salary budget, not a Cypress or BrowserStack line item. The architectural common denominator: an agent that decides what to test rather than executing a script a human wrote. Given the 86% error-handling miss rate in agent-authored PRs, I'd want to know whether these agents have the same blind spot as the agents writing the code.
